I have the same model of TV with the difference that it is 65". I have exactly the same problem. Setting the "local dimming" in the options to standard, or high, I immediately get the problem of the screen dimming for 2-3 seconds, every 15 seconds or so. After turning off "local dimming", the problem disappears. Evidently, this is the fault of bad TV software, which Samsung does not want to fix. My TV is still under warranty, and I wonder if there is even a possibility to return it for a defect that the manufacturer does not want to fix.
Have you somehow managed to fix the problem? Watching any HDR content with "local dimming" turned off, misses the point, because the picture is devoid of quality. The TV in this form is inoperable.
Also have the 65". Decided to go into the service menu and disable auto dimming. I understand it might void the warranty, but there is no point having a great TV and fuming each time there is a dark scene.
